The FISA reports are crucial documents that authorize the government to conduct surveillance on foreign targets suspected of engaging in espionage or terrorism. These reports are subject to strict scrutiny and must be approved by a federal judge before any surveillance can take place. The broader context of FISA reports in the United States is also worth examining. Since the passage of the USA PATRIOT Act in 2001, the government has expanded its surveillance powers, leading to increased reliance on FISA warrants. This expansion has raised concerns about the potential for abuse of these powers and the impact on civil liberties.
